Microsoft's Windows Phone 7 Series is Missing Copy and Paste

It can't be all rosy, now can it? Despite the plethora of news coming out of MIX10 yesterday, we were definitely expecting some kind of shade to come over the glowing press the mobile Operating System was getting. Here it is, folks. It looks like Microsoft is not including Copy and Paste into the Windows Phone 7 Series suite of features. We know, we know. We're sure that you can't really find a good reason for this, but maybe if you try, you can ignore the fact that Windows Mobile of yesteryear has been enjoying the feature pretty much from the start. And yes, if you're wondering, that also means that there won't be any clipboard functionality. So, no cut, either.
